Output 43132411ecbb7b4331a6d9e4eef5093bca8a43938cde3cbbb4598ed1dee12fc6:0

value
58289
script pubkey
OP_0 OP_PUSHBYTES_20 4d3a79000505dd65a24106b581efeff9194f5499
address
bc1qf5a8jqq9qhwktgjpq66crml0lyv574yeg7mqtl
transaction
43132411ecbb7b4331a6d9e4eef5093bca8a43938cde3cbbb4598ed1dee12fc6
confirmations
195817
spent
true